What is a Door Contractor?
A door contractor is a knowledgeable professional who concentrates on the installation, repair, and upkeep of doors in residential and business properties. They have extensive understanding of different door products, designs, and hardware, allowing them to provide tailored options for various customer needs. From picking the ideal door to its installation, a door contractor is necessary for making sure that the doors work effectively and enhance the aesthetic appeal of a space.
Secret Responsibilities of a Door Contractor
Consultation and Assessment: A door contractor starts by assessing the particular needs of a task. This typically includes evaluating existing doors and hardware, talking about style preferences, and recommending suitable choices.

Installation: After picking the proper door and hardware, the contractor proceeds with installation. This includes precise measurements, cutting, fitting, and ensuring that all components are safely attached.

Repair and Maintenance: A door contractor likewise focuses on fixing doors, including repairing frames, changing hardware, and adjusting hinges. Routine upkeep services can assist extend the life of doors and enhance their efficiency.

Modification: In some cases, clients may need custom doors that fit special areas or match particular design visual appeals. A competent door contractor will work with various products and surfaces to create bespoke options.

Kinds Of Doors Handled by Door Contractors
Door professionals deal with different door types. Here are a few of the most typical ones:
Type of DoorDescriptionInterior DoorsGenerally utilized for rooms within a home, made of wood, MDF, or hollow-core products.Exterior DoorsDeveloped for outdoors entrances, typically made from tough products like fiberglass, wood, or steel.Sliding DoorsThese doors slide open horizontally, typically utilized for patio areas or closets.French DoorsDefined by two hinged doors that open outside, ideal for producing a stylish entryway.Bi-fold DoorsMade up of multiple panels that fold back to save area, typically used in laundry rooms or closets.Garage DoorsParticular to garages, these doors can be by hand run or automated.Factors to Consider When Hiring a Door Contractor

Typical FAQs about Door ContractorsWhat is the typical cost of employing a door contractor?
The cost can differ substantially based on the type of door, intricacy of installation, and local prices. On average, homeowners can expect to pay between ₤ 200 and ₤ 1000, including materials and labor.
For how long does it take to install a door?
The installation time can vary based on the door type and the contractor's expertise. Generally, a simple installation can take anywhere from two to 5 hours.
Are door repair work worth it, or should I simply replace the door?
It depends upon the degree of the damage. Minor repairs-- like fixing broken hinges or replacing hardware-- are typically worth it, while badly harmed doors may need changing for safety and aesthetic reasons.
How do I understand if my door needs changing?
Indications that a door may require changing include warping, fractures, difficulty opening and closing, rust (in metal doors), or bad insulation.
Can I install a door myself?
While DIY installation is possible, it needs knowledge of carpentry, accurate measurements, and an understanding of door mechanics. Working with a professional is typically suggested for optimal outcomes.
